**Ticket QJ-4182: Expired creds breaking baseline uploads**

Hey plugin folks — a bunch of you noticed that Lintbarn started rejecting baseline file uploads on Tuesday. Turns out the shared credential for the baseline-store service expired and nobody got the calendar nudge. We've rotated it, so you'll need to update your plugin config before your next scan, or the baseline diff will come back empty. The new key for the baseline-store endpoint is below.

app token of fahaf-yafof = kto2_sf

**Ticket: Config drift on Wavelet gateway nodes**

Hey, quick one for review. Half the Wavelet websocket nodes still have per-message deflate enabled while the others turned it off after the CPU spike two weeks ago. So we're trading bandwidth on some boxes and burning cores on others, and nobody decided on purpose. Latency graphs look noisy because of it. I want to pin one canonical set. Current values on the drifted nodes are below.

settings of fafog-yajof:
ulaael:
  log_level: warn
  metrics_host: metrics.ulaael.zemvarlabs.internal
  pin: 7979
  pool_size: 32

**Ticket #4182 — Scanner bridge creds expired (again)**

Hey plugin folks — the shared credential the Scanlet barcode bridge uses to push scan events into Cartwheel expired over the weekend, so anything your plugins sent since Saturday got 401'd and dropped. We've rotated it and bumped the expiry to 12 months so this stops being a quarterly surprise. Replays for the dropped window kick off tonight. Update your plugin configs before then or you'll just re-queue failures. The new key for the Cartwheel ingest endpoint is below.

API key for yahig-tadup: kto7_ubizbYm

Subject: Key rotation for the Relevance Notes service

Team,

As part of our quarterly rotation, the credential used to pull search relevance tuning notes from the Bramblewick notes service was replaced this morning. The old key stops working at end of day Friday. If you use the notes lookup while troubleshooting customer ranking complaints, update your saved configuration before then. Nothing else changes: endpoints, scopes, and rate limits stay the same. The replacement key for the Bramblewick notes service is below.

API key for tagug-tajef: vxb4-R1fo